World Bank Loan to Preserve Natural and Cultural Assets Around Peru's Machu Picchu The World Bank Board of Executive Directors has approved a $5 million loan to support the Government of Peru’s efforts to protect some of Peru’s most important cultural sites in the Vilcanota Valley, including Machu Picchu and the Sacred Valley of the Incas.
